If you're looking to stash some cash for a short to medium term, Flagstar Bank just rolled out some pretty tempting CD rates. As of early May 2024, they're offering a 5.50% APY on a 7-month term and 5.15% APY on a 15-month term. That's competitive, especially when you consider the minimum deposit is only $500. Let's break down what you need to know before you jump in.

Why These Rates Stand Out

Right now, many online banks are offering rates around 4-5% for CDs, but Flagstar's 5.50% for a 7-month term is definitely on the higher end. It's a great option if you want to lock in a strong return without tying up your money for too long. The 15-month option at 5.15% is also solid if you're willing to commit a bit longer.

The $500 minimum is pretty accessible — you don't need a huge chunk of change to get started. And since these are online accounts, the whole process is pretty straightforward. You can apply from anywhere in the country.

What to Watch Out For

Before you rush to open an account, keep a few things in mind. First, there's an early withdrawal penalty. That means if you need to pull your money out before the CD matures, you'll lose some interest. Make sure you're comfortable locking up your cash for the full term.

Also, while the rates are great right now, they could change. Flagstar doesn't guarantee that these rates will stay the same forever. So if you see a deal you like, it's smart to act quickly. And always compare with other top CD rates to make sure you're getting the best deal for your situation.

  • Early withdrawal penalty applies — plan to keep the money in for the full term.
  • Rates are subject to change without notice.
  • No monthly fees if held to maturity, but check the fine print.

How to Get Started

Opening a CD with Flagstar is a simple online process. You'll need to provide some personal information, fund the account with at least $500, and choose your term. The bank will handle the rest. Just remember, once you open it, the rate is locked in for the duration.

If you're not sure which term to pick, think about your financial goals. Need the money in less than a year? Go with the 7-month. Have a bit more time? The 15-month gives you a slightly lower rate but a longer lock-in.

Common Questions

Is the $500 minimum deposit required for both CD terms?

Yes, both the 7-month and 15-month CDs require a minimum deposit of $500.

What happens if I withdraw money early from the CD?

There is an early withdrawal penalty, which means you'll lose some of the interest you've earned. It's best to keep the money in for the full term.

Are these rates guaranteed once I open the CD?

Yes, once you open the CD and fund it, the rate is locked in for the entire term. However, the rates themselves can change for new accounts at any time.
